I bought the $49 version for my iMac and I am very happy with it. I have over 500 games in a PGN file and this app was very helpfull in helping me prepare for opponents in my recent club championship where we played one G/90 a week. (USCF MSA - Cross Table for PARMA CLUB CHAMPIONSHIP (Event 201210304102)). But it is not often that club players will know in advance who they will be playing and have time to prepare.

It took me a few hours to clean up my pgn file so that all of the names were spelled consistently.(like Bob vs. Robert).

I was able to add Stockfish as an engine so I have two engines. Not as good as the engine selections on WIndows, but enough for my level of play.

It reads PGN files in to memory (instead of converting to another database format) and it is very fast in searching. The 35,000 game 'Top Games' file that comes with the app takes about 7 seconds to load. I type 'Carlsen' in the filter and instantly the filter has the 863 games of his in the filter.

I built a PGN file of about 500,000 games and it took about a minute to load and about 2 seconds to find the games by 'Carlsen'. But the links to players and the player list took so long to load you would think that the program was locked up. So the size of the files that come with the app is probably the practical limit.

The filtering is good, you can look at thier web site docs for the details.

A few years ago I bought Chess Base 10 and ran it using VMWare. I gave up on it after a while. The HIARCS Chess Explorer if fine for what I need.
